Tuesday (September 17): “The ‘trajectory’ of the relationship between India and the US has been “upwards” amid various administrations in Washington, be it Bush, Obama and now Trump,”  External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ar said today addressing the 100-day press conference of the Ministry of External Affairs.

“There is no facet of the relationship today which has not gone upward over the period of 20 years,” he said.

On trade and commerce front, Mr. Jaishankar said the trade problem between the two countries is “normal”. “As relationship grows, there will be problems … the only way you don’t have trade problems is when you do not trade,” he said.

Prime Minister will be on a six-day visit to the US, beginning September 22. In respect of Modi’s visit to US and Jaishankar said, Modi addressed events in San Jose in 2015 and Madison Square in New York in 2014, and the September 22 event at Houston will be the third.

With reference to the decision of US President Donald Trump to attend the ‘Howdy Modi’ event, he said, “I regard this as a great achievement of the Indo-US community. If you have someone like the President (of the US) coming there, this shows where the community has reached, how it is regarded in the US … it is a matter of great honour and we will welcome him (Trump) in the warmest possible manner.”

On how the message of Trump’s presence at the Modi event will send to Pakistan, he said it is up to Islamabad to read.

About PoK (Pakistan occupied Kashmir) he said that the part of Kashmir controlled by Pakistan belongs to India and that he expected India to gain physical control over it one day, raising the rhetoric over the territorial dispute.
